Output 53d7c34076cafd3d5c4894de762ddebf174f70a42c9fa20f55d8836e6a9bdc06:1

value
1829999165
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71c3e80c29738c6c9453968c656905b30795ef43 OP_EQUAL
address
3C4Yy3BKNfmZZw7Ccd1818H5z3ThKuysi9
transaction
53d7c34076cafd3d5c4894de762ddebf174f70a42c9fa20f55d8836e6a9bdc06
confirmations
221891
spent
true